4.6 Connecting to a Controlling Host
As a controlling host, you can use:
Computer
Base Unit
For operating the power sensor, you can choose from various possibilities. For
details, see Chapter 6, "Operating Concepts", on page 31.
4.6.1 Computer
If the controlling host is a computer, you can operate the power sensor using a
supported software, the web user interface or remote control. For details, see
Chapter 6, "Operating Concepts", on page 31.
Establish the connection using:
Host interface
See Chapter 4.6.1.1, "Simple USB Connection", on page 14.
See Chapter 4.6.1.2, "R&S NRPZ5 Sensor Hub Setup", on page 15.
LAN interface, if the power sensor is a LAN power sensor
See Chapter 4.6.3, "Using a LAN Connection", on page 18.
4.6.1.1 Simple USB Connection
All R&S NRP power sensors can be connected to the USB interface of a com-
puter.
Required equipment
R&S NRP power sensor
R&S NRPZKU cable
